Alex Brooker is a British journalist and television presenter best known for co-hosting Channel 4’s The Last Leg. Born with a congenital physical condition that affected his hands and legs, he has become one of the UK’s most recognisable disabled media figures, with a career that spans local newspapers, national sports coverage, and prime‑time entertainment.
Brooker’s journey from regional sports reporter to a regular face on Channel 4 is marked by candid discussions about disability, a growing family, and a net worth that has drawn public curiosity. What Disability Does Alex Brooker Have?

- Brooker was born with congenital hand and arm deformities and a twisted right leg that required amputation when he was a baby.
- He now wears a prosthetic leg and has dexterity issues that affect gripping objects such as pens.
- As a child, he underwent surgeries at Great Ormond Street Hospital, including an operation on his left hand to improve grip.
- He used an occupational therapist until his teenage years but now performs “pretty much everything without assistance.”
- In the BBC Two documentary Alex Brooker: Disability and Me, he discussed the deep impact of his disability on his identity.
- Brooker has expressed fear that his children might inherit his condition.
- He entered Channel 4’s “Half a Million Quid Talent Search” in 2012, which sought disabled talent for the 2012 Summer Paralympics.

What Is Alex Brooker’s Net Worth and How Did He Build His Career?
Early Career in Journalism
After graduating from Liverpool John Moores University in 2006 with a journalism degree, Brooker worked as a sports reporter for the Liverpool Echo and later for the Press Association. His break into television came when he applied for Channel 4’s “Half a Million Quid Talent Search” in 2012, a competition designed to find disabled talent for the network’s Paralympic coverage. He won a role as a trackside reporter for the 2011 BT Paralympic World Cup and went on to interview then‑Prime Minister David Cameron and then‑Mayor Boris Johnson during the 2012 Summer Paralympics.
Rise to National Television
Since 2012, Brooker has been a main co‑host of Channel 4’s The Last Leg alongside Adam Hills and Josh Widdicombe. He has also co‑presented The Jump with Davina McCall (2014), presented The Superhumans Show (2016), and appeared on Celebrity Juice, Deal or No Deal for Soccer Aid, and Meet the Richardsons. In 2012 he won The Million Pound Drop Live.
